Discover more about Stephen Northup House

Step into a piece of history at the Stephen Northup House, a remarkable historical landmark located in the picturesque North Kingstown, Rhode Island. Built in the 18th century, this house showcases the unique architectural style of the period, offering a glimpse into the life of early American settlers. The house is not just an architectural wonder; it is also a testament to the region’s rich cultural heritage. As you wander through its halls, you can imagine the stories that these walls have witnessed over the centuries. Guided tours may be available, allowing you to delve deeper into the history of the house and its original inhabitants.The surrounding area is equally enchanting, with lush gardens and scenic views that make for perfect photo opportunities. The Stephen Northup House is situated near other historical sites and attractions, making it an ideal stop for history buffs and casual visitors alike.     Getting There

    Car

    If you're traveling by car, start by getting onto I-95 S from your current location in Newport County. Follow I-95 S for approximately 15 miles. Take exit 3A to merge onto US-1 S toward Narragansett. Continue on US-1 S for about 10 miles, then take the exit toward RI-1A N. Merge onto RI-1A N and continue for about 2 miles. Finally, turn left onto Featherbed Ln. The Stephen Northup House will be located on your right at 99 Featherbed Ln, North Kingstown, RI 02852.

    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, start by taking the RIPTA bus #14 from Newport to the Wickford Junction train station. This bus ride will take approximately 30 minutes. Once you arrive at Wickford Junction, transfer to bus #66 toward North Kingstown. This will take you to the nearest stop on US-1. From there, it's about a 1-mile walk to Featherbed Ln. Follow US-1 N, then turn left onto Featherbed Ln. The Stephen Northup House will be on your right at 99 Featherbed Ln, North Kingstown, RI 02852. Please check the RIPTA website for the latest schedules and fare information, which may incur a small fee.
